PaulStoffregen 9b44b17006 Document bandlimit waveforms | pirms 3 gadiem | |
---|---|---|
docs | pirms 6 gadiem | |
examples | pirms 3 gadiem | |
extras | pirms 3 gadiem | |
gui | pirms 3 gadiem | |
utility | pirms 3 gadiem | |
.gitignore | pirms 8 gadiem | |
.travis.yml | pirms 8 gadiem | |
Audio.h | pirms 3 gadiem | |
AudioControl.h | pirms 10 gadiem | |
Quantizer.cpp | pirms 4 gadiem | |
Quantizer.h | pirms 4 gadiem | |
README.md | pirms 3 gadiem | |
Resampler.cpp | pirms 4 gadiem | |
Resampler.h | pirms 4 gadiem | |
analyze_fft256.cpp | pirms 3 gadiem | |
analyze_fft256.h | pirms 7 gadiem | |
analyze_fft1024.cpp | pirms 5 gadiem | |
analyze_fft1024.h | pirms 8 gadiem | |
analyze_notefreq.cpp | pirms 6 gadiem | |
analyze_notefreq.h | pirms 8 gadiem | |
analyze_peak.cpp | pirms 6 gadiem | |
analyze_peak.h | pirms 8 gadiem | |
analyze_print.cpp | pirms 6 gadiem | |
analyze_print.h | pirms 8 gadiem | |
analyze_rms.cpp | pirms 5 gadiem | |
analyze_rms.h | pirms 8 gadiem | |
analyze_tonedetect.cpp | pirms 5 gadiem | |
analyze_tonedetect.h | pirms 8 gadiem | |
async_input_spdif3.cpp | pirms 4 gadiem | |
async_input_spdif3.h | pirms 4 gadiem | |
biquad.h | pirms 4 gadiem | |
control_ak4558.cpp | pirms 6 gadiem | |
control_ak4558.h | pirms 8 gadiem | |
control_cs4272.cpp | pirms 6 gadiem | |
control_cs4272.h | pirms 8 gadiem | |
control_cs42448.cpp | pirms 5 gadiem | |
control_cs42448.h | pirms 7 gadiem | |
control_sgtl5000.cpp | pirms 3 gadiem | |
control_sgtl5000.h | pirms 3 gadiem | |
control_tlv320aic3206.cpp | pirms 6 gadiem | |
control_tlv320aic3206.h | pirms 6 gadiem | |
control_wm8731.cpp | pirms 5 gadiem | |
control_wm8731.h | pirms 6 gadiem | |
data_bandlimit_step.c | pirms 4 gadiem | |
data_spdif.c | pirms 5 gadiem | |
data_ulaw.c | pirms 10 gadiem | |
data_waveforms.c | pirms 10 gadiem | |
data_windows.c | pirms 10 gadiem | |
effect_bitcrusher.cpp | pirms 6 gadiem | |
effect_bitcrusher.h | pirms 8 gadiem | |
effect_chorus.cpp | pirms 6 gadiem | |
effect_chorus.h | pirms 8 gadiem | |
effect_combine.cpp | pirms 6 gadiem | |
effect_combine.h | pirms 6 gadiem | |
effect_delay.cpp | pirms 6 gadiem | |
effect_delay.h | pirms 4 gadiem | |
effect_delay_ext.cpp | pirms 6 gadiem | |
effect_delay_ext.h | pirms 7 gadiem | |
effect_envelope.cpp | pirms 6 gadiem | |
effect_envelope.h | pirms 6 gadiem | |
effect_fade.cpp | pirms 6 gadiem | |
effect_fade.h | pirms 8 gadiem | |
effect_flange.cpp | pirms 6 gadiem | |
effect_flange.h | pirms 8 gadiem | |
effect_freeverb.cpp | pirms 4 gadiem | |
effect_freeverb.h | pirms 6 gadiem | |
effect_granular.cpp | pirms 6 gadiem | |
effect_granular.h | pirms 6 gadiem | |
effect_midside.cpp | pirms 5 gadiem | |
effect_midside.h | pirms 8 gadiem | |
effect_multiply.cpp | pirms 5 gadiem | |
effect_multiply.h | pirms 8 gadiem | |
effect_rectifier.cpp | pirms 3 gadiem | |
effect_rectifier.h | pirms 4 gadiem | |
effect_reverb.cpp | pirms 6 gadiem | |
effect_reverb.h | pirms 8 gadiem | |
effect_waveshaper.cpp | pirms 6 gadiem | |
effect_waveshaper.h | pirms 7 gadiem | |
filter_biquad.cpp | pirms 5 gadiem | |
filter_biquad.h | pirms 8 gadiem | |
filter_fir.cpp | pirms 6 gadiem | |
filter_fir.h | pirms 8 gadiem | |
filter_fir.md | pirms 10 gadiem | |
filter_ladder.cpp | pirms 3 gadiem | |
filter_ladder.h | pirms 3 gadiem | |
filter_variable.cpp | pirms 5 gadiem | |
filter_variable.h | pirms 8 gadiem | |
input_adc.cpp | pirms 4 gadiem | |
input_adc.h | pirms 4 gadiem | |
input_adcs.cpp | pirms 4 gadiem | |
input_adcs.h | pirms 7 gadiem | |
input_i2s.cpp | pirms 3 gadiem | |
input_i2s.h | pirms 3 gadiem | |
input_i2s2.cpp | pirms 4 gadiem | |
input_i2s2.h | pirms 5 gadiem | |
input_i2s_hex.cpp | pirms 4 gadiem | |
input_i2s_hex.h | pirms 4 gadiem | |
input_i2s_oct.cpp | pirms 4 gadiem | |
input_i2s_oct.h | pirms 4 gadiem | |
input_i2s_quad.cpp | pirms 4 gadiem | |
input_i2s_quad.h | pirms 8 gadiem | |
input_pdm.cpp | pirms 3 gadiem | |
input_pdm.h | pirms 6 gadiem | |
input_spdif3.cpp | pirms 4 gadiem | |
input_spdif3.h | pirms 4 gadiem | |
input_tdm.cpp | pirms 5 gadiem | |
input_tdm.h | pirms 7 gadiem | |
input_tdm2.cpp | pirms 5 gadiem | |
input_tdm2.h | pirms 5 gadiem | |
keywords.txt | pirms 3 gadiem | |
library.json | pirms 8 gadiem | |
library.properties | pirms 8 gadiem | |
memcpy_audio.S | pirms 5 gadiem | |
memcpy_audio.h | pirms 8 gadiem | |
mixer.cpp | pirms 5 gadiem | |
mixer.h | pirms 5 gadiem | |
multiplier.md | pirms 10 gadiem | |
new_objects.md | pirms 10 gadiem | |
output_adat.cpp | pirms 4 gadiem | |
output_adat.h | pirms 6 gadiem | |
output_dac.cpp | pirms 4 gadiem | |
output_dac.h | pirms 8 gadiem | |
output_dacs.cpp | pirms 4 gadiem | |
output_dacs.h | pirms 8 gadiem | |
output_i2s.cpp | pirms 3 gadiem | |
output_i2s.h | pirms 3 gadiem | |
output_i2s2.cpp | pirms 4 gadiem | |
output_i2s2.h | pirms 5 gadiem | |
output_i2s_hex.cpp | pirms 4 gadiem | |
output_i2s_hex.h | pirms 4 gadiem | |
output_i2s_oct.cpp | pirms 4 gadiem | |
output_i2s_oct.h | pirms 4 gadiem | |
output_i2s_quad.cpp | pirms 4 gadiem | |
output_i2s_quad.h | pirms 8 gadiem | |
output_mqs.cpp | pirms 3 gadiem | |
output_mqs.h | pirms 5 gadiem | |
output_pt8211.cpp | pirms 3 gadiem | |
output_pt8211.h | pirms 3 gadiem | |
output_pt8211_2.cpp | pirms 3 gadiem | |
output_pt8211_2.h | pirms 5 gadiem | |
output_pwm.cpp | pirms 4 gadiem | |
output_pwm.h | pirms 4 gadiem | |
output_spdif.cpp | pirms 4 gadiem | |
output_spdif.h | pirms 5 gadiem | |
output_spdif2.cpp | pirms 4 gadiem | |
output_spdif2.h | pirms 5 gadiem | |
output_spdif3.cpp | pirms 4 gadiem | |
output_spdif3.h | pirms 4 gadiem | |
output_tdm.cpp | pirms 4 gadiem | |
output_tdm.h | pirms 7 gadiem | |
output_tdm2.cpp | pirms 5 gadiem | |
output_tdm2.h | pirms 5 gadiem | |
play_memory.cpp | pirms 6 gadiem | |
play_memory.h | pirms 8 gadiem | |
play_queue.cpp | pirms 4 gadiem | |
play_queue.h | pirms 4 gadiem | |
play_sd_raw.cpp | pirms 6 gadiem | |
play_sd_raw.h | pirms 8 gadiem | |
play_sd_wav.cpp | pirms 4 gadiem | |
play_sd_wav.h | pirms 4 gadiem | |
play_serialflash_raw.cpp | pirms 6 gadiem | |
play_serialflash_raw.h | pirms 8 gadiem | |
record_queue.cpp | pirms 4 gadiem | |
record_queue.h | pirms 4 gadiem | |
spi_interrupt.cpp | pirms 6 gadiem | |
spi_interrupt.h | pirms 8 gadiem | |
synth_dc.cpp | pirms 6 gadiem | |
synth_dc.h | pirms 5 gadiem | |
synth_karplusstrong.cpp | pirms 4 gadiem | |
synth_karplusstrong.h | pirms 8 gadiem | |
synth_pinknoise.cpp | pirms 6 gadiem | |
synth_pinknoise.h | pirms 8 gadiem | |
synth_pwm.cpp | pirms 5 gadiem | |
synth_pwm.h | pirms 7 gadiem | |
synth_simple_drum.cpp | pirms 4 gadiem | |
synth_simple_drum.h | pirms 8 gadiem | |
synth_sine.cpp | pirms 5 gadiem | |
synth_sine.h | pirms 8 gadiem | |
synth_tonesweep.cpp | pirms 4 gadiem | |
synth_tonesweep.h | pirms 6 gadiem | |
synth_waveform.cpp | pirms 3 gadiem | |
synth_waveform.h | pirms 4 gadiem | |
synth_waveform.md | pirms 10 gadiem | |
synth_wavetable.cpp | pirms 4 gadiem | |
synth_wavetable.h | pirms 6 gadiem | |
synth_whitenoise.cpp | pirms 5 gadiem | |
synth_whitenoise.h | pirms 8 gadiem |
16 bit, 44.1 kHz streaming audio library for Teensy 3.x and Teensy 4.x, featuring:
http://www.pjrc.com/teensy/td_libs_Audio.html
Use this graphical tool to design your audio project. Easily browse the library’s many features, connect objects, export to Arduino code, and quickly access details for the functions each object provides for you to control it from your Arduino sketch!
http://www.pjrc.com/teensy/gui/index.html
Audio Adaptor Board for 16 bit stereo input and output.
Dual Audio Adaptor Boards for quad channel 16 bit input and output.
Teensy 3.6, Teensy 3.5, Teensy 3.2, or Teensy 3.1 12 bit DAC Output (Mono)
Teensy 3.6, Teensy 3.5, Teensy 3.2, Teensy 3.1 or Teensy 3.0 ADC Input (Mono)
Teensy 3.6, Teensy 3.5, or Teensy 3.2 ADC Input (Stereo)
Teensy 3.6 or Teensy 3.5 12 bit DAC Output (Stereo)
Teensy 3.6, Teensy 3.5, Teensy 3.2, Teensy 3.1 or Teensy 3.0 PWM Output (Mono)
USB Audio: Bi-Directional Stereo Streaming to a PC